Executive Summary
SaaS companies often outgrow finance stacks built around disconnected billing tools, spreadsheets, local accounting workarounds, and manually reconciled reporting. The pressure increases when the business expands into multiple legal entities, currencies, tax jurisdictions, and operating models such as direct sales, partner-led sales, usage-based billing, annual contracts, and service bundles. A successful SaaS ERP Modernization Strategy for Subscription Billing and Multi-Entity Financial Operations must therefore do more than replace software. It must redesign financial control, revenue operations, governance, and integration architecture around scalable business processes.
For enterprise Odoo programs, the strongest outcomes come from a phased implementation methodology that starts with discovery and assessment, validates business process fit, defines a target operating model, and then aligns functional design, technical design, data migration, testing, and change management to measurable business priorities. In this context, Odoo can be highly effective when deployed with disciplined solution architecture, careful multi-company design, API-first integration, and a cloud operating model that supports resilience, observability, and enterprise scalability. What business problem should modernization solve first?
The first executive question is not which modules to deploy. It is which business constraints are limiting growth, control, and reporting confidence. In SaaS environments, the most common constraints are fragmented subscription lifecycle management, inconsistent invoicing rules across entities, delayed revenue recognition support processes, weak intercompany controls, poor visibility into deferred revenue and collections, and manual consolidation at month-end. These issues create downstream risk in forecasting, board reporting, compliance, and customer experience.
A business-first modernization program should define target outcomes such as faster close cycles, standardized billing policies, cleaner entity-level reporting, stronger auditability, reduced manual reconciliations, and better alignment between CRM, contracts, billing, accounting, and analytics. This framing keeps the ERP initiative anchored in business process optimization rather than feature accumulation.
How should discovery, assessment, and gap analysis be structured?
Discovery should map the current operating model across quote-to-cash, contract-to-revenue, procure-to-pay, record-to-report, and intercompany processes. For SaaS organizations, this means documenting how subscriptions are created, amended, renewed, suspended, upgraded, downgraded, invoiced, collected, recognized, and reported across all entities. It also means identifying where finance teams rely on spreadsheets, where sales operations overrides standard rules, and where local entities have created nonstandard workarounds.
Gap analysis should compare current-state processes against the target-state capabilities available through standard Odoo applications, carefully selected extensions, and integration patterns. Odoo Subscription and Accounting are often central to the design, but the assessment may also justify CRM, Sales, Helpdesk, Project, Documents, Knowledge, Spreadsheet, and Studio depending on the operating model. OCA module evaluation can be appropriate when a requirement is common, maintainable, and better addressed through community-proven patterns than bespoke customization. However, every OCA candidate should be reviewed for version compatibility, maintainability, security posture, and long-term support implications.
| Assessment Area | Key Questions | Implementation Output |
|---|---|---|
| Subscription operations | How are plans, renewals, amendments, credits, and usage events managed today? | Target billing model and process ownership |
| Multi-entity finance | Which entities require separate ledgers, tax rules, local reporting, and intercompany flows? | Multi-company design principles and chart governance |
| Integration landscape | Which systems own CRM, payments, tax, support, data warehouse, and identity? | API-first integration architecture and sequencing |
| Data quality | Where are customer, product, contract, and accounting records inconsistent? | Migration scope and master data governance plan |
| Controls and compliance | Which approvals, audit trails, segregation rules, and retention policies are required? | Governance, security, and control framework |
What does the target solution architecture look like for SaaS finance?
The target architecture should separate business capabilities clearly: customer and opportunity management, subscription and contract administration, invoicing and collections, accounting and consolidation support, analytics, and external services such as payment gateways, tax engines, identity providers, and data platforms. An API-first architecture is essential because SaaS businesses rarely operate in a single-system reality. The ERP should become the system of record for financial transactions and governed master data domains, while adjacent platforms continue to serve specialized functions where justified.
From a technical design perspective, integration patterns should favor event-driven or service-based interfaces over manual file exchanges wherever practical. This improves timeliness, traceability, and resilience. Identity and Access Management should be aligned with enterprise policies so that role-based access, approval authority, and segregation of duties are enforced consistently across entities. For cloud ERP deployments, the architecture should also define environments, release controls, backup policies, disaster recovery expectations, and observability requirements from the start rather than after go-live.
- Use Odoo Accounting and Subscription as the financial process core when recurring billing, invoicing cadence, and customer contract visibility need to be unified.
- Use CRM and Sales when quote-to-contract handoff is a root cause of billing errors or renewal leakage.
- Use Documents and Knowledge when approval evidence, policy control, and operating procedures must be embedded into execution.
- Use Studio selectively for low-risk extensions, not as a substitute for architecture discipline.
- Retain external specialist platforms only where they provide clear business value, such as tax determination, payment orchestration, or enterprise analytics.
How should functional design handle subscription billing and multi-company management?
Functional design should begin with billing policy standardization. Many SaaS organizations discover that the real challenge is not software capability but inconsistent commercial rules. The design should define subscription products, pricing structures, billing frequencies, amendment rules, credit memo policies, renewal workflows, dunning logic, and exception handling. If usage-based charging exists, the design must specify the source of usage events, validation rules, timing of rating, and reconciliation ownership.
For multi-company management, the design should establish which legal entities operate independently, which share customers or vendors, how intercompany transactions are initiated and settled, and how local statutory needs differ from group reporting needs. Chart of accounts governance, tax configuration standards, fiscal positions, journals, payment terms, and approval matrices should be harmonized where possible while preserving legal compliance. If the business also operates multiple fulfillment locations for hardware bundles, onboarding kits, or regional stock, a multi-warehouse implementation may be relevant, but only when inventory is materially connected to the subscription business model.
What configuration and customization strategy reduces long-term risk?
The safest enterprise pattern is configuration first, extension second, customization last. Odoo implementations become expensive to maintain when teams encode policy exceptions into custom logic before standardizing the process. Configuration strategy should therefore prioritize legal entity setup, accounting structures, subscription templates, invoicing rules, approval flows, access rights, and reporting dimensions using standard capabilities wherever feasible.
Customization strategy should be reserved for requirements that create measurable business value and cannot be addressed through standard features, disciplined process redesign, or supportable extensions. Each customization should have a named business owner, a documented rationale, test coverage, upgrade impact assessment, and retirement criteria. OCA module evaluation is useful here because some recurring enterprise needs may already have maintainable solutions, but governance is critical. Not every available module belongs in a production architecture.
How should data migration and master data governance be managed?
Data migration is often the hidden determinant of ERP credibility. For SaaS finance, the migration scope typically includes customers, contacts, products, price books, active subscriptions, contract terms, open invoices, payment history, tax attributes, chart mappings, and opening balances. The program should distinguish between historical data needed for operational continuity and data better retained in an archive or analytics platform.
Master data governance should define ownership for customer records, product catalog structures, subscription plans, legal entity attributes, tax settings, and financial dimensions. Without this, the new ERP quickly reproduces the same reporting inconsistencies it was meant to eliminate. A practical migration approach uses multiple mock loads, reconciliation checkpoints, exception logs, and sign-off by both finance and business process owners. The objective is not only technical conversion but trust in the resulting numbers.
What integration, testing, and security disciplines are essential before go-live?
Integration strategy should prioritize the systems that directly affect billing accuracy, cash collection, and reporting integrity. Typical priorities include CRM, payment providers, tax services, support systems, identity providers, banking interfaces, and analytics platforms. APIs should be versioned, monitored, and documented with clear ownership. Error handling and replay procedures matter as much as the initial interface design because subscription businesses cannot afford silent transaction failures.
Testing should be organized around business risk, not only technical completeness. User Acceptance Testing must validate end-to-end scenarios such as new subscription creation, mid-term amendment, renewal, cancellation, intercompany recharge, credit issuance, payment allocation, and month-end close. Performance testing is important when invoice generation, renewal runs, or integration bursts create peak loads. Security testing should verify access controls, approval segregation, audit trails, API authentication, and sensitive data exposure. In cloud deployments, this should be complemented by monitoring and observability across application, database, and integration layers. Where relevant to the operating model, technologies such as PostgreSQL, Redis, Docker, and Kubernetes should be governed as part of the platform architecture rather than treated as isolated infrastructure choices.
| Test Stream | Primary Objective | Executive Concern Addressed |
|---|---|---|
| UAT | Validate real business scenarios and policy compliance | Operational readiness and user confidence |
| Performance testing | Confirm billing, posting, and integration throughput under load | Scalability during close and renewal cycles |
| Security testing | Verify access, segregation, API controls, and auditability | Compliance, risk, and governance |
| Migration reconciliation | Prove balances, contracts, and open items are accurate | Financial trust at cutover |
How do training, change management, and governance determine adoption?
Training strategy should be role-based and scenario-based. Finance controllers, billing specialists, sales operations, entity administrators, and executives need different learning paths tied to the decisions they make in the system. Training should use the configured environment and real process examples, not generic demonstrations. Knowledge transfer must also include support procedures, issue triage, and release governance so the organization can operate the platform after the implementation team steps back.
Organizational change management is especially important when modernization standardizes processes that local teams previously controlled independently. Executive governance should therefore include a steering structure with clear decision rights for scope, policy exceptions, data ownership, and cutover readiness. Project governance should track risks such as uncontrolled customization, unresolved data defects, weak process ownership, and integration dependencies. What should go-live, hypercare, and continuous improvement look like?
Go-live planning should define cutover sequencing, freeze windows, reconciliation checkpoints, fallback criteria, communication plans, and command-center responsibilities. For multi-entity deployments, a phased rollout is often safer than a single global cutover, especially when tax, banking, or local reporting complexity varies by region. Business continuity planning should cover invoice generation continuity, payment processing continuity, backup validation, and incident escalation paths.
Hypercare should focus on transaction accuracy, close-cycle stability, user support responsiveness, and rapid remediation of integration or data issues. After stabilization, continuous improvement should move into a governed backlog that prioritizes workflow automation, analytics enhancements, approval optimization, and AI-assisted implementation opportunities such as test case generation, document classification, migration validation support, and anomaly detection in billing or collections. AI should accelerate quality and insight, not bypass governance. The long-term objective is an ERP operating model that supports enterprise architecture discipline, stronger analytics, and scalable growth across entities.
- Establish executive KPIs before design begins, including close-cycle performance, billing accuracy, collection visibility, and manual effort reduction.
- Standardize commercial and finance policies before approving custom development.
- Treat multi-company design, intercompany rules, and chart governance as core architecture decisions, not configuration details.
- Use API-first integration and observability to reduce hidden operational risk.
- Plan hypercare and continuous improvement as funded phases, not afterthoughts.
